Massive injuries have finally caught up with this team. They have lost 3 defensive starters for the year (McFarland, Morris, Freeney). They have been without their #3 and #4 cornerbacks for a few weeks, leaving their kick returner to fill in as a nickel corner. They have also had problems keeping Keiaho healthy. Hagler has been nicked.

 

On offense, Harrison, Ugoh, Addai, Clark, Gonzalez, Diem, Utecht, and Moorehead have been regulars on the injury report. They were able to deal with it for a while, but it's catching up. Not only do we need some guys to come back healthy, but we need guys to stop getting hurt. It's ridiculous.
